When you visit a mechanic, make sure to ask lots of questions. Ask what caused your problem in the first place to avoid the issue happening in the future. An ounce of prevention can save you a lot of money over time.

Keep a record of any vehicle repairs. If your car has issues in the future, it is useful to be able to give your mechanic all such records. The records can help the mechanic determine the problem.

Look up reviews of local auto shops online. This lets you know how other people who have tried this mechanic before have felt about the services they provide. You can use the information to find a place you’ll feel comfortable enough with to fix your car.

Do not pay an auto mechanic until you have test driven your car to be sure they did their job. Many people fail to do this and they end up having the same problem that they had before taking the car in to get it repaired.

Never leave any valuables in your car when dropping it off for repairs. Mechanics might have to empty the inside of your vehicle and they cannot be held responsible if you discover something missing. You should also remove items from your trunk.

Don’t put off washing your vehicle during the winter time. Though it might seem futile, the winter months can cause lots of damage. Sand and salt on the roads can cause rust and corrosion. Best be sure to dry your car before driving so that you won’t let any ice form on your car.

You should check the tire pressure when you go to the gas station. Take a look at each tire and be sure they are free of any debris. If you spot an issue, don’t put off getting it repaired. Driving with faulty tires is extremely dangerous.
